What Can I expect in terms of Fuel Economy?

Around 10% on given sufficient motorway mileage.

Why ?: Fuel economy is measured in Miles per Gallon or litres per 100 km.
If you spend a lot of time stuck in congestion or waiting for traffic lights, the engine is idling (consuming fuel) for zero miles/km travelled.

In Scientific tests involving isolated engines Militec-1 has improved fuel economy by up to 7%, as these engines are maintained and calibrated to work at optimum levels (for scientific research), there is no doubt that Militec actually works. However users often report very high improvements in fuel economy (10+ to 30%) which should not be expected unless you spend a considerable (almost all) of your normal driving on motorways or experience un-congested rural driving. (Above 10% is the exception rather than the rule.)

What Can I expect in terms of Reduced Exhaust Pollution?

In a standard MOT style test, expect a 50% drop.

Under laboratory conditions, Brunel university have confirmed this [50% drop in smoke] for diesel engines, however you should be aware that a "standard MOT test" occurs with an RPM of between 1,000 RPM to 2,000 RPM, on a level surface and they never apply engine load. When load range and the RPM range of a engine is tested the reduction is less impressive, the largest drop [15% min, 40% max] was in HC (hydro carbons) across the RPM and load range. (e.g. Load is an empty truck compared with a fully loaded truck on various inclines.)  [Note: A reduction in HC means less unburnt fuel in exhaust systems/or reduced fuel wastage.]

Is Militec-1 is best anti-friction oil available?

No - it is not. There is a group of lubricates that contain "Chlorinated Paraffin's" which provide far superior initial lubrication. However due to a chemical reaction that occurs in engines or/and on metal surfaces, which is caused by stress, friction and heat, "Chlorinated Paraffin's" result in the formation of "Choride Ions", which in turn when exposed to water vapour* combined with more "stress, friction and heat", result in the formation of "Hydrochloric Acid" which eats and damages metal surfaces. (If you use such products, your engine, gearbox etc. will be damaged.)

* Ambient air contains water vapour. 

In general you should be wary of (and avoid) oil products that contain:

  • "Chlorinated Paraffin"
  • Solid Particles (e.g. Teflon®/PTFE)
  • Viscosity enhancers.
  • Carrier Oils.
  • Solvents.

Teflon® is the registered trade mark of DUPONT.

Note: Zinc, Molybdenum Disulfide and/or sulphur are added at source to some types of engine and gearbox oils, this is normal industry practice however, avoid them in additive form a too much of "a good thing" will have an adverse effect.

Will Militec-1 Effect my Warrantee ?

The use of an oil does not effect warrantees, damage effects warrantees.

i.e. Warrantees inevitably always contain a "catch all" clause which covers the manufacturer against unforeseen damage. It will go something like this:

"If you perform any modifications or use any product not recommended by [warrantee company] and this later results in damage, then this damage will not be covered and your warrantee may be limited".
